FWIW, when FC4 was EOL'd, I mass updated the fc4 targeted BZ tickets
into NEEDINFO state with the following comment:
----
This report targets the FC3 or FC4 products, which have now been EOL'd.
Could you please check that it still applies to a current Fedora release, and
either update the target product or close it ?
Thanks.
----
470 fc4-targeted tickets are still in this state (which I think I'll
just WONTFIX close soon).
I seem to remember some folks did as asked, and a few sent me hate
mails about not fixing the problem... :-)
I can do a mass update to NEEDINFO for the fc5 blocking bugs if we
decide that's the best way to go.
